{"id":173729,"date":"2026-02-18T21:56:54","date_gmt":"2026-02-18T20:56:54","guid":{"rendered":"https:\/\/liora.io\/en\/?p=173729"},"modified":"2026-02-18T21:56:54","modified_gmt":"2026-02-18T20:56:54","slug":"open-sql-file-complete-tutorial","status":"publish","type":"post","link":"https:\/\/liora.io\/en\/open-sql-file-complete-tutorial","title":{"rendered":"Open SQL file : Complete tutorial"},"content":{"rendered":"<p><strong>SQL files (Structured Query Language) hold code that outlines the structure and contents of a database. Opening a SQL file facilitates the execution of code to modify the database&#8217;s contents. The SQL file also includes commands for creating content, inserting, deleting, splitting, or updating data. Accessing a SQL file is swift when using MySQL or a text editor.<\/strong><\/p>\n<!-- \/wp:post-content -->\n\n<!-- wp:heading -->\n<h2 id=\"h-use-mysql-or-a-text-editor-to-open-a-sql-file\" class=\"wp-block-heading\">Use MySQL or a text editor to open a SQL file<\/h2>\n<!-- \/wp:heading -->\n\n<!-- wp:paragraph -->\n<p>To <a href=\"https:\/\/liora.io\/en\/sql-tutorial-top-5-most-useful-methods\">open an SQL file,<\/a> you need to have suitable software. There is no shortage of choices for this purpose! The preferred solution is, of course, to <a href=\"https:\/\/liora.io\/en\/demystifying-mysql-a-comprehensive-guide-to-relational-data-managemen\">securely install MySQL.<\/a> The second option to consider is opening this type of file using a text editor: Notepad for a Windows computer and TextEdit for a Mac.<\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:paragraph -->\n<p>However, there are many solutions on the market for <a href=\"https:\/\/liora.io\/en\/sql-vs-nosql\">opening an SQL file:<\/a><\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:list -->\n<ul class=\"wp-block-list\"><!-- wp:list-item -->\n<li>RazorSQL<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>DatabaseSpy<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>Microsoft Visual Studio<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>Sublime Text<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>FileMaker Pro<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>BBEdit<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>SQLEditor<\/li>\n<!-- \/wp:list-item -->\n\n<!-- wp:list-item -->\n<li>And many more.<\/li>\n<!-- \/wp:list-item --><\/ul>\n<!-- \/wp:list -->\n\n<!-- wp:paragraph -->\n<p>Choose the software that you are most familiar with or have already installed on your machine. For SQL experts, note that it is also <a href=\"https:\/\/liora.io\/en\/sql-learn-all-about-the-programming-language-for-databases\">possible to open an SQL file<\/a> and view the database content with software like phpMyAdmin or SQL Server Management Studio. Once the software is installed, simply right-click, choose &#8220;Open with,&#8221; and then select the application of your choice.<\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:image {\"sizeSlug\":\"large\",\"align\":\"center\"} -->\n\n<!-- \/wp:image -->\n\n<!-- wp:buttons {\"className\":\"is-layout-flex wp-block-buttons-is-layout-flex is-content-justification-center\",\"layout\":{\"type\":\"flex\",\"justifyContent\":\"center\"}} -->\n<div class=\"wp-block-buttons is-layout-flex wp-block-buttons-is-layout-flex is-content-justification-center\"><!-- wp:button -->\n<div class=\"wp-block-button\"><a class=\"wp-block-button__link wp-element-button\" href=\"https:\/\/liora.io\/en\/courses\/\">Discover our courses<\/a><\/div>\n<!-- \/wp:button --><\/div>\n<!-- \/wp:buttons -->\n\n<!-- wp:heading -->\n<h2 id=\"h-how-do-i-check-the-status-of-my-sql-file\" class=\"wp-block-heading\">How do I check the status of my SQL file?<\/h2>\n<!-- \/wp:heading -->\n\n<!-- wp:paragraph -->\n<p>If your file doesn&#8217;t open, start by checking that your file indeed has the &#8220;.sql&#8221; extension. If it doesn&#8217;t, please download your document again. If this document was provided by a third party, ask them to provide you with a copy of the document with the correct extension. The file in question may be infected with a virus.<\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:paragraph -->\n<p>Perform a check using an antivirus or a file analysis system. If the file has been partially downloaded, is damaged, or corrupted, it&#8217;s best to <a href=\"https:\/\/liora.io\/en\/like-sql-how-to-use-this-search-function\">request a new SQL file.<\/a><\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:heading -->\n<h3 id=\"h-how-to-check-for-software-updates\" class=\"wp-block-heading\">How to check for software updates?<\/h3>\n<!-- \/wp:heading -->\n\n<!-- wp:paragraph -->\n<p>Finally, the last point to ensure the<strong> opening of Structured Query Language Data Format<\/strong> files is to check the version of the installed software. Regardless of the solution chosen to open your file, make sure that the application is up to date.<\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:paragraph -->\n<p>Similarly, consider setting this software as the default application for opening an SQL file. To do this, simply check the box that says &#8220;Always use this program to open SQL files&#8221; on Windows or &#8220;this change will be applied to all files with the SQL extension&#8221; on Mac.<\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:heading {\"level\":3} -->\n<h2 id=\"h-conclusion\" class=\"wp-block-heading\">Conclusion<\/h2>\n<!-- \/wp:heading -->\n\n<!-- wp:paragraph -->\n<p>You can open an SQL file with a text editor or a tool like MySQL. If the file doesn&#8217;t open, consider checking for updates for your tool, ensuring the &#8220;.sql&#8221; extension is correct, and verifying the file&#8217;s integrity using antivirus software. You can also try opening it with another software from the list mentioned earlier.<\/p>\n<!-- \/wp:paragraph -->\n\n<!-- wp:buttons {\"className\":\"is-layout-flex wp-block-buttons-is-layout-flex is-content-justification-center\",\"layout\":{\"type\":\"flex\",\"justifyContent\":\"center\"}} -->\n<div class=\"wp-block-buttons is-layout-flex wp-block-buttons-is-layout-flex is-content-justification-center\"><!-- wp:button -->\n<div class=\"wp-block-button\"><a class=\"wp-block-button__link wp-element-button\" href=\"https:\/\/liora.io\/en\/courses\/\">Starting your SQL training<\/a><\/div>\n<!-- \/wp:button --><\/div>\n<!-- \/wp:buttons -->\n\n<!-- wp:html -->\n<script type=\"application\/ld+json\">\n{\n  \"@context\": \"https:\/\/schema.org\",\n  \"@type\": \"FAQPage\",\n  \"mainEntity\": [\n    {\n      \"@type\": \"Question\",\n      \"name\": \"Use MySQL or a text editor to open a SQL file\",\n      \"acceptedAnswer\": {\n        \"@type\": \"Answer\",\n        \"text\": \"To open an SQL file, you need to have suitable software such as MySQL or a text editor like Notepad on Windows or TextEdit on Mac to access and view the SQL code.\" \n      }\n    },\n    {\n      \"@type\": \"Question\",\n      \"name\": \"How do I check the status of my SQL file?\",\n      \"acceptedAnswer\": {\n        \"@type\": \"Answer\",\n        \"text\": \"If your file doesn\u2019t open, start by checking that it has the \u201c.sql\u201d extension, and if it doesn\u2019t or is corrupted, consider re\u2011downloading it or scanning it with antivirus software.\u00a0:contentReference[oaicite:0]{index=0}\"\n      }\n    },\n    {\n      \"@type\": \"Question\",\n      \"name\": \"How to check for software updates?\",\n      \"acceptedAnswer\": {\n        \"@type\": \"Answer\",\n        \"text\": \"Ensure that the software you use to open SQL files is up to date and consider setting it as the default application to improve compatibility and functionality.\u00a0:contentReference[oaicite:1]{index=1}\"\n      }\n    },\n    {\n      \"@type\": \"Question\",\n      \"name\": \"Conclusion\",\n      \"acceptedAnswer\": {\n        \"@type\": \"Answer\",\n        \"text\": \"You can open an SQL file with a text editor or a tool like MySQL, and if it doesn\u2019t open, verify the extension, update your software, and check the file integrity.\u00a0:contentReference[oaicite:2]{index=2}\"\n      }\n    }\n  ]\n}\n<\/script>\n\n<!-- \/wp:html -->","protected":false},"excerpt":{"rendered":"<p>SQL files (Structured Query Language) hold code that outlines the structure and contents of a database. Opening a SQL file facilitates the execution of code to modify the database&#8217;s contents. The SQL file also includes commands for creating content, inserting, deleting, splitting, or updating data. Accessing a SQL file is swift when using MySQL or [&hellip;]<\/p>\n","protected":false},"author":47,"featured_media":207291,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_acf_changed":false,"editor_notices":[],"footnotes":""},"categories":[2433],"class_list":["post-173729","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-data-ai"],"acf":[],"_links":{"self":[{"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/posts\/173729","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/users\/47"}],"replies":[{"embeddable":true,"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/comments?post=173729"}],"version-history":[{"count":5,"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/posts\/173729\/revisions"}],"predecessor-version":[{"id":207292,"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/posts\/173729\/revisions\/207292"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/media\/207291"}],"wp:attachment":[{"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/media?parent=173729"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/liora.io\/en\/wp-json\/wp\/v2\/categories?post=173729"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}